Output f3060fcbf0e0200b81ab1710dc92c8f961d693efc5dcd6459bd678d27a04dfb1:6

value
26330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9181bc8ee545a4b9e4b632217239d82b8931c9b1 OP_EQUAL
address
3ExPKcWc3yp2kFcDatECtKALwXKPd87oWC
transaction
f3060fcbf0e0200b81ab1710dc92c8f961d693efc5dcd6459bd678d27a04dfb1
confirmations
477010
spent
true